imToken 交易接口是其重要组成部分,它具备多种功能,如支持多种数字货币交易等,在应用方面,可用于便捷的数字货币转账等场景,但安全考量不容忽视,需防范私钥泄露等风险,保障用户资产安全,其功能为用户提供便利,应用场景丰富,然而安全是关键,只有确保安全,才能让用户放心使用其交易接口进行数字货币相关操作。
在数字货币交易蓬勃发展的当下,imToken 作为一款颇具知名度的数字钱包应用,其交易接口备受开发者与用户瞩目,imToken 交易接口宛如一座关键桥梁,为搭建各类数字货币相关的应用与服务提供了有力支撑,本文将全方位、细致地探讨其功能、应用场景以及安全方面的关键要点。
imToken 交易接口的功能
(一)交易发起
借助该接口,开发者能够达成用户在自身应用中直接发起数字货币交易的目标,以一个去中心化的电商平台应用为例,当用户选中商品后,调用 imToken 交易接口,输入交易金额等相关信息,便可顺利完成向商家支付数字货币的操作,此接口能够精准获取用户的钱包地址、余额等信息,为交易的准确性提供坚实保障。
(二)交易查询
开发者可运用接口查询特定交易的状态,当用户发起一笔转账交易后,应用通过接口持续查询该交易在区块链上的确认状况,无论是处于待确认状态,还是已成功确认,亦或是因某些缘由失败,都能实时获取,从而及时向用户反馈交易进度。
(三)钱包管理拓展
接口还支持钱包管理功能的延伸拓展,例如获取钱包的资产列表,涵盖不同数字货币的持有数量、最新价格等信息,这对于开发数字货币资产管理类应用具有极大价值,用户能够在一个应用中清晰明了地看到自己在 imToken 钱包里的所有资产状况。
imToken 交易接口的应用场景
(一)去中心化金融(DeFi)应用
在 DeFi 领域,各类借贷、交易、流动性挖矿等应用均离不开数字货币的交易操作,imToken 交易接口可使 DeFi 应用更便捷地与用户的钱包交互,以一个 DeFi 借贷平台为例,用户通过接口授权后,平台能够调用接口实现抵押资产的锁定(如锁定一定数量的 ETH 作为抵押)以及借款的发放(将相应的稳定币转入用户钱包)等操作。
(二)数字货币支付集成
对于支持数字货币支付的线上线下商家而言,集成 imToken 交易接口可拓宽支付渠道,线上商城可在结算页面增设数字货币支付选项,调用接口完成支付流程;线下商家借助扫码设备等,利用接口实现用户扫码支付数字货币,提升支付的多样性与灵活性。
(三)区块链游戏
区块链游戏中涉及虚拟资产的交易、奖励发放等环节,imToken 交易接口可用于游戏内数字货币的转账,例如玩家在游戏中获得奖励代币,游戏服务器通过接口将代币转入玩家的 imToken 钱包;或者玩家之间交易游戏道具对应的数字货币结算,均可通过接口高效实现。
imToken 交易接口的安全考量
(一)权限管理
接口的使用务必严格进行权限控制,开发者需确保只有经过用户授权的操作方可调用接口,在获取用户钱包信息或发起交易时,必须通过安全的授权流程,如 OAuth 等方式,让用户清晰知晓并同意操作,杜绝未经授权的访问与交易。
(二)数据加密
在接口传输数据过程中,需对敏感信息进行加密处理,用户的钱包私钥等关键数据严禁明文传输,应采用 SSL/TLS 等加密协议,确保数据在网络传输过程中的安全性,防止被黑客截取与窃取。
(三)交易验证与监控
对于通过接口发起的交易,要实施多重验证,除了区块链本身的交易确认机制外,应用层面也可设置一些规则,如交易金额的合理性检查(防范大额异常交易)、交易频率限制等,建立交易监控系统,实时监测接口调用情况与交易行为,一旦发现异常(如短时间内大量异常交易请求),迅速采取措施,如暂停接口调用、通知用户等。
imToken 交易接口凭借其丰富多样的功能,在数字货币相关的众多应用场景中扮演着举足轻重的角色,在使用过程中,安全始终是核心要务,开发者应高度重视权限管理、数据加密和交易监控等安全措施,确保接口稳定、安全运行,为用户提供可靠的数字货币交易交互体验,助力数字货币应用生态的健康发展,随着数字货币技术与应用的持续演进,imToken 交易接口也有望不断优化与拓展,以满足更多创新应用的需求。
转载请注明出处:qbadmin,如有疑问,请联系()。
本文地址:https://www.whsqjy.com/jgdh/852.html
